[Mozambique] INCM will apply measures to facilitate the recovery of TMCEL

979

Tuaha Chabone Mote, PCA of the regulatory authority for the telecommunications sector, understands that the bankruptcy of TMCEL would jeopardize the stability of the communications sector and make the telecommunications market unattractive for investment.

"In this sense, the INCM, in coordination with the sectoral supervision and other competent entities, is doing everything possible to find a solution that is viable and sustainable, both for the State and for TMCEL“, said the PCA.

In this sense, the INCM it will apply measures that facilitate the operator's work, so that it can return to work and honor its commitments in the market. He explained that, unlike a financial regulator that can intervene, for example, in the case of a commercial bank failing, the law does not allow the INCM to pay the debts of mobile phone operators.

"The competent authorities will announce the paths to be taken, but we guarantee that the measures aim to make the TMCEL efficient, that it can generate wealth, profit and undergo reforms“, he said.

The PCA of the INCM was speaking within the scope of the celebrations of the 30th anniversary of the public institution, having revealed, on the occasion, that, soon, it will expand the offer capacity of the 3G technology of the telecommunications operators in the country.

Thus, each operator will go from eight megahertz to 10 and the service will make it possible to increase its capacity and improve the quality of service.

Given the high pressure for spectrum, the communications regulatory authority decided to make available to the three mobile operators, on a lease basis, the spectrum reserved for a potential fourth mobile operator.

Another novelty was the announcement of entry into operation of the internet operator – Starlink – in October this year, in the country, from whom high quality, fast and cheap internet is expected.

"Starlink's entry into the Mozambican market will allow for the materialization of the expansion and implementation of digital squares, as well as some public sector institutions for free“, and the project to digitize libraries in capital cities will be launched, so that people have access to digital books in various areas.

Regarding cases of fraud, through telephone messages, the INCM guaranteed that, with the launch of the platform for complaints six months ago, investigations are still ongoing to find the criminals, with the Attorney General's Office and mobile operators.
